On Wed, 12 Apr 2006, martin wrote: > also, just wonder why at spam.log, some scanned message can't log down > msgid > (which at maillog using)
Because some messages arrive at your MTA without a msgid to log (usually a sign of either a forged message or a brain-damaged sending MTA). The standard sendmail config will add a locally generated msgid to such messages but the "milter" interface is handed the message in the form that it arrived (IE before any local header adding or modification).
